BULLMASTIFF LITTER INFO
———————————
LITTER: MISSY’S DARK MASKED BEAUTIES
Sire (Photo Below): Devernon Sytten Jock
Dam (Photo Below): SargeThrust Miss Missy
Mating Dates: 13 to 15 January 2017
Amount of pups: 7 (3 males, 4 females)
Date of Birth: 13 March 2017
Selection from: 15 April 2017
Planned inoculation & microchipping date: 01 May 2017
Microchip brand: GetMeKnown (click for more info) Inoculation: Nobivac® Canine 1-DAPPv (click for more info)
Planned “release ready” date: 14 May 2017
KUSA Registration by: Before end of July 2017

Missy is a beautiful Fawn girl with the most gentle nature. She is loving and gentle with children. Jock is a real Jock… and a massive brindle.
Jock and Missy
Mating colours: Fawn Female & Brindle Male
Update: 17 May 2017. Bullmastiff pups 8.5 weeks old.All pups booked
Last 2 Male pups are leaving this week. Export permits are being finalised during the week by the transport company.These boys are very large and we are so happy with them over all.
Update: 03 May 2017. Bullmastiff pups 7.5 weeks old. Pups doing exceptionally well. They are very wrinkly, have dark masks and are of the size and build within standard that we hoped for. We are very happy with their progress. They will leave within the next week. A reminder to non-SA buyers to please ensure that import permits are finalised during the week. Update: 24 March 2017. Bullmastiff pups 1 week old. (3 Pups booked; 3 available). We have not notified other breeders of the birth of the litter. They are truly large pups and already weighs more than our usual fawn pups at this age. There is only one red female and one very dark male. All have nice and full masks. Exceptional perfect dark masks: Update: 15 March 2017. (3 Pups booked; 3 available). As predicted, the pups were born with exceptional dark masks on 13 March. Missy is an exceptional mother and handles her pups with care. She has too much milk for the seven and already developed slight mastitis which we are treating carefully. 4 Females 3 Males Update: 15 January 2017. (2 Pupsbooked; 6 available). Mating done. We will know if we were successful in four weeks. We expect to see few (if any) brindles since previous generations had mainly fawn and red genes. The brindle gene will promote large dogs with dark masks. What to expect from this litter:
